Metabolic Testing


medgem small image 2.jpgMany factors such as age, height, weight, body composition and gender can affect one’s metabolism. The MedGem® device, an indirect calorimeter, can measure your resting metabolic rate (RMR) to determine the number of calories the body burns to perform basic bodily functions (such as heart rate, brain activity, breathing, etc). A person’s RMR can represent up to 75% of the total metabolism. Determining an accurate resting metabolic rate is important in evaluating a person’s calories needs for weight loss or gain.

 

How Does It Work?


The measurement is easy to administer and provides immediate results. You simply need to relax and breathe into the device for approximately 7-10 minutes. A report is generated that allows for a personalized meal plan based on your individual calorie needs.

Guidelines for Accurate Testing:
  • 1. Do not eat or consume caffeine 4 hours prior to testing (water is allowed).
  • 2. Do not exercise 4 hours prior to testing.
  • 3. Avoid smoking or nicotine 1 hour prior to testing.
Interventions to Increase Metabolism:
  • 1. Do not skip meal; eat every 3-4 hours.
  • 2. Do not restrict your intake below 1000-1200 calories.
  • 3. Get adequate sleep 7-8 hours per night.
  • 4. Include strength training exercise to increase lean body mass.
